Retirement investment planning is one of the most critical components of a comprehensive financial strategy. It involves selecting and managing assets in a way that ensures you accumulate sufficient wealth to maintain your lifestyle when regular income stops. Starting early and investing consistently are foundational principles that significantly increase the probability of reaching your retirement goals.

Effective retirement planning requires an understanding of time horizons and risk profiles. Younger investors can typically afford more exposure to growth-oriented assets like equities, while those nearing retirement often shift toward more conservative holdings like bonds or annuities. Balancing these shifts is essential to preserve capital while still achieving growth.

Tax-advantaged retirement accounts, such as IRAs and 401(k)s, play a pivotal role in this process. Contributing the maximum allowed and taking advantage of employer matches where available can substantially enhance your retirement corpus. Additionally, estimating post-retirement expenses, factoring in healthcare, inflation, and potential lifestyle changes, provides clarity on how much is enough.

Ultimately, retirement investment planning is about peace of mind. It’s a long-term commitment that rewards consistency, patience, and informed decision-making—allowing you to enjoy your later years without financial stress.
